Which type of solar panel is good
The three main types of solar panels are monocrystalline, polycrystalline, and thin film. Polycrystalline solar panels can be the most cost-effective. Learn efficiency, cost, and performance differences to choose the best panels for your home in 2025. When deciding, consider factors like your budget, roof size, sun exposure, and energy efficiency goals.

How much does a solar panel for home appliances cost
Based on our 2025 survey of 1,000 solar customers, the national average price for a single solar panel professionally installed is $1,200. This means most full-size systems of between 20 and 30 panels cost between $24,000 and $36,000.
